Key Features to Look for in a Construction Business Credit Card
In the multifaceted world of business financing, one size certainly does not fit all. When evaluating credit cards for your construction business, keep an eye on these critical features:
- Reward Points and Cash Back: Look for cards that offer rewards on everyday business expenses. This might include bonus points for fuel, tool purchases, office supplies, and even travel expenses if your business involves site visits across different cities.
- Low Interest Rates and Introductory Offers: Many credit card providers offer enticing 0% APR introductory periods, giving you a window to manage large purchases without the immediate burden of high interest.
- No or Low Annual Fees: While some premium cards offer excellent rewards, they might come with higher annual fees. Evaluate whether the fee is justified by the benefits provided, especially when your focus is on maintaining a healthy cash flow.
- Expense Management Tools: Integrated reporting features and expense tracking software can help you monitor spending, simplify bookkeeping, and even categorize expenses by project.
- Credit Building Opportunities: For newer construction businesses, the ability to build or repair your credit score is crucial. Find cards that report to major credit bureaus and help you establish a robust financial history.
- Security and Fraud Protection: With sophisticated cybersecurity measures and fraud monitoring services, ensure your transactions are secure and that you’re promptly alerted to any suspicious activity.

Applying and Qualifying for Your Ideal Credit Card
Now that you know what to look for, the next step is putting your best foot forward when applying for these credit card offers. Here are some tips to secure the ideal credit card for your construction business:
- Credit Score Matters: Ensure that your credit score is in good shape before applying, as a strong credit history can unlock better interest rates and more generous rewards.
- Prepare Your Financials: Lenders will want to see detailed documentation of your business revenue, expenditures, and future projections. Keep your financial records well-organized to streamline the application process.
- Understand the Terms: Go beyond the sign-up bonus. Read the fine print regarding annual fees, interest rates, and any restrictions on rewards redemption to ensure the card truly meets your needs.
- Tailor Your Application: If possible, highlight how your construction business’s unique operations align with the rewards and benefits of the card you’re applying for.

Frequently Asked Questions About Credit Cards for Construction Businesses
Here are some common questions to help you navigate the maze of options and decide on the best credit card for your construction business in 2025.
1. What makes construction business credit cards different from regular business cards?
Construction business credit cards are specifically tailored for industries with heavy expenses like materials, fuel, and equipment rental. They often include rewards and benefits that align with these spending categories, making them ideal for managing cash flow and reducing overall costs.
2. Can credit card rewards actually help reduce operational costs?
Absolutely. Many cards offer cash back, bonus points, or rewards that can be redeemed on critical business expenses such as fuel, equipment, supplies, or even travel. When used strategically, these rewards can significantly lower your operating costs.
3. What should I do if my construction business is just starting out?
For startups, it’s important to look for cards with credit-building features, low fees, and flexible payment options. Establish a good credit history by consistently managing expenses and paying off balances on time.
4. How can I utilize digital tools to manage my credit card spending?
Many modern credit cards come with integrated apps and expense management software. These tools allow you to track transactions in real time, categorize expenses by project, and even receive alerts for unusual activity. Leveraging these digital resources can simplify bookkeeping and keep your financial strategy on track.
5. Are there any hidden fees I should be aware of?
Always read the fine print. While many cards offer appealing rewards, they may also come with annual fees, late payment penalties, or foreign transaction fees. Compare all fees carefully to ensure that the card actually saves you money in the long run.
6. How do I qualify for 0% introductory APR offers?
Maintaining a good credit score and preparing a robust set of business financials are key. Lenders assess your credit history, revenue, and overall financial health before approving such offers. A strong application increases your chances of securing these favorable introductory rates.
7. Can I upgrade my credit limits as my business grows?
Many credit cards offer flexible credit limit increases after a period of responsible use. Regular monitoring of your spending and maintaining a good payment history can put you in a prime position to request an upgrade when needed.
8. What kind of customer support should I expect?
Look for credit card providers that offer dedicated business customer support, online chat, and robust mobile apps. Good support is crucial, especially if you encounter any issues that could disrupt your operations.
